Java+SpringBoot图书销售系统毕业设计项目(源码+演示视频)

版权申诉
0 下载量 100 浏览量 更新于2024-11-11 收藏 35.44MB ZIP 举报
资源摘要信息:"基于Java+SpringBoot的在线图书销售系统是一个结合了Java语言和SpringBoot框架的完整项目,它旨在为用户提供一个在线环境下的图书购买和管理平台。通过B/S架构模式设计,本系统实现了管理员、教师和学生三种用户角色的区分管理,各自拥有不同的操作权限和功能。 在项目技术方面,系统主要使用了Java作为后端开发语言,结合了MySQL作为数据库管理系统,并通过SpringBoot框架进行业务逻辑的处理和程序结构的整合。SpringBoot的特性包括自动配置、独立部署、无需外部依赖的Servlet容器等,能够简化企业级应用开发的难度。 系统实现了以下功能: 1. 管理员功能:系统管理员具有网站整体管理的能力,可以进行班级、学院信息的管理,以及图书信息、借阅信息和学生信息的管理。 2. 学生和教师功能:作为系统的主要使用用户,学生和教师可以查询图书信息、借阅信息,同时还能查看到本人的借阅情况。 该系统采用的是B/S架构,即浏览器/服务器架构,用户通过浏览器访问系统提供的功能,而服务器端则处理业务逻辑和数据存储。这种模式易于扩展、升级,同时也方便用户使用。 标签方面,该项目为Java项目,具有丰富的Java源码,并被归类为毕业设计和Java实战类别的项目,适合于学习和实践Java语言及其相关技术。 压缩包中的文件列表包含了安装启动步骤说明、运行环境说明、演示视频及源码等,为用户提供了一个从了解项目到实际运行项目的全套资料。 具体文件说明如下: - 安装启动步骤.txt:包含了如何下载、配置、安装及启动整个在线图书销售系统的详细步骤。 - 运行环境说明.txt:描述了系统的运行环境要求,包括Java版本、SpringBoot版本、数据库类型等。 - Java毕业设计-基于springboot的在线图书销售系统(vue)演示(源码+演示视频).zip:包含了完整的源代码和系统操作演示视频,帮助用户更好地理解系统功能和操作流程。 - 程序:此目录应包含系统的所有编译后的程序文件,以及运行程序所需的配置文件和资源文件。 - 数据库:此目录应包含数据库文件,可能包括数据库结构、表定义以及数据导出文件等,以便用户可以重建或访问数据库内容。 总结来说,这个基于Java+SpringBoot的在线图书销售系统是一个功能全面的毕业设计项目,适合用于学习Java后端开发、数据库管理以及B/S架构系统设计。对于IT专业学生和技术人员来说,该系统是一个很好的实践案例和参考模板。"